minimize size
-------------
This plugin can be used to reduce the size of the resulting image. Often
virtual volumes are much smaller than their reported size until any data
is written to them. During the bootstrapping process temporary data like
the aptitude cache is written to the volume only to be removed again.
The minimize size plugin employs three different strategies to keep a
low volume footprint:
- Mount folders from the host into key locations of the image volume to
avoid any unneccesary disk writes.
- Use `zerofree <http://intgat.tigress.co.uk/rmy/uml/index.html>`__ to
deallocate unused sectors on the volume. On an unpartitioned volume
this will be done for the entire volume, while it will only happen on
the root partition for partitioned volumes.
- Use
`vmware-vdiskmanager <https://www.vmware.com/support/ws45/doc/disks_vdiskmanager_eg_ws.html>`__
to shrink the real volume size (only applicable when using vmdk
backing). The tool is part of the `VMWare
Workstation <https://my.vmware.com/web/vmware/info/slug/desktop_end_user_computing/vmware_workstation/10_0>`__
package.
Settings
~~~~~~~~
- ``zerofree``: Specifies if it should mark unallocated blocks as
zeroes, so the volume could be better shrunk after this.
Valid values: true, false
Default: false
*``optional``*
- ``shrink``: Whether the volume should be shrunk. This setting works
best in conjunction with the zerofree tool.
Valid values: true, false
Default: false
*``optional``*
